Adding limited access AP - best way?

Wed Feb 22, 2012 6:45 am

I currently have everything connected to a switch, linked to Mikrotik 450G - everything sees everything, no access limitations within LAN

Now I need to add a new AP with limited access to a certain IPs, so I'm thinking to plug it into next free interface on the router to be able to apply Filter rules

What is the recommended way to implement limited access to certain IPs for this AP's clients: should I put the new AP to a separate subnet, or use VLAN, etc?
